drivers/intel/fsp2_0: Set basename for FSP binaries
Since there is no standardized naming scheme for the
FSP binaries, the option USE_FSP_REPO can't be used
on some platforms, because some of the filenames differ
and the build process awaits "Fsp_*.fd" as filename.
As a workaround, add the option -n to SplitFspBin.py,
which defines the basename.
